  2. The chronic pain pathway involves the following steps:
    1. Pain starts in receptor nerve cells beneath the skin and in organs throughout the body.
    2. These receptor cells send messages along nerve pathways to the spinal cord.
    3. The spinal cord carries the message to the brain.
    4. Pain medicine can reduce or block these messages before they reach the brain1.
    5. During the transition from acute to chronic pain, certain signal transduction pathways involving glial cells are activated, switching them from an anti-inflammatory role to a pro-inflammatory one2.

    Pain starts in receptor nerve cells found beneath the skin and in organs throughout the body. When you are sick, injured, or have other type of problem, these receptor cells send messages along nerve pathways to the spinal cord, which then carries the message to the brain. Pain medicine reduces or blocks these messages before they reach the brain.

    Ji and other researchers have found that during the transition stage from acute to chronic pain, there is activation of certain signal transduction pathways that involve glial cells. This activation switches them from their anti-inflammatory, supportive role to a pro-inflammatory one.

    What is a pain pathway?Pain pathways represent a complex sensory system, with cognitive, emotional, and behavioral elements having evolved to detect and integrate a protective response to noxious stimuli [ 7 ]. In humans, this system involves both primitive spinal reflexes and complex conscious and subconscious supraspinal responses.

    What are the three pathways of chronic pain?Chronic pain can be anatomically and phenomenologically dissected into three separable but interacting pathways, a lateral ‘painfulness’ pathway, a medial ‘suffering’ pathway and a descending pain inhibitory pathway. One may have pain (fullness) without suffering and suffering without pain (fullness).
    How do pain pathways work in the central nervous system?Neuroscience research indicates pain pathways in the central nervous system (CNS) often work in conjunction with emotions. Pain pathways can also be stimulated by peripheral tissues and traumatic experiences [ 15 ]. The biopsychosocial model views illness as a complex interaction between psychological, social, and biological factors [ 16 ].
